Issues Found During the Ford Mustang Oil Leak Repair
Upon inspecting the Ford Mustang, our technicians discovered several areas that were causing the oil leak. Below is a breakdown of the issues we found and the solutions we implemented:
1. Worn Oil Pan Gasket
The oil pan gasket seals the oil pan to the engine block, ensuring that the engine oil stays contained. Over time, heat and constant engine vibrations can cause the gasket to wear out and become brittle, resulting in oil leaks.
Solution: We replaced the old, worn-out oil pan gasket with a high-quality replacement that provided a strong, leak-proof seal. This fix eliminated the oil leak and ensured that the engine’s oil remained properly contained, protecting the engine from further damage.
2. Damaged Valve Cover Gasket
The valve cover gasket plays a crucial role in preventing oil from leaking out of the engine’s valve cover. When this gasket becomes damaged, oil can seep out, potentially causing engine misfires and damage.
Solution: Our technicians replaced the faulty valve cover gasket with a new one that provided a tight, reliable seal. This stopped the oil leak and helped to maintain the engine’s overall health by preventing contaminants from entering.
3. Cracked Oil Filter Housing
The oil filter housing holds the oil filter in place and prevents oil from leaking around it. If the housing cracks, oil can escape, leading to oil leakage and a potential loss of oil pressure.
Solution: We replaced the cracked oil filter housing with a new, durable part that securely holds the oil filter. This repair stopped the oil leak and restored the integrity of the oil filter system, ensuring proper oil filtration and circulation.
4. Worn Oil Seals
Oil seals are essential components that prevent oil from leaking out of various engine parts. Over time, seals can wear out due to constant engine heat and pressure, causing oil to leak around them.
Solution: We replaced the worn oil seals with high-quality replacements to ensure that oil leakage was stopped at every critical point. This repair helped preserve the engine’s internal components, keeping everything lubricated and functioning properly.
5. Damaged Oil Cooler Hoses
The oil cooler hoses are responsible for circulating oil through the oil cooler to prevent the engine from overheating. If these hoses become cracked or damaged, they can leak oil, reducing the system’s ability to regulate engine temperature.
Solution: We replaced the damaged oil cooler hoses with new, durable hoses designed to withstand high pressures and temperatures. This repair eliminated the oil leak and ensured that the oil cooler system could function efficiently, maintaining proper engine temperature.

How to Prevent Oil Leaks in Your Ford Mustang
Preventing oil leaks requires proactive maintenance and regular inspections. Here are some tips to help you avoid oil leaks and maintain your Ford Mustang in top condition:
- Regularly Check Oil Levels: Keep an eye on your vehicle’s oil levels and watch for any signs of oil loss. This will help you spot a leak early and prevent further engine damage.
- Schedule Regular Maintenance: Regularly servicing your car at a trusted car garage near me helps identify potential issues before they become serious problems. Regular inspections can catch leaks in the early stages.
- Replace Worn Gaskets and Seals: As your car ages, gaskets and seals will naturally wear out. Be sure to replace them at the recommended intervals to prevent oil from leaking out.
- Use Quality Oil: Always use high-quality oil to ensure smooth engine operation. Poor-quality oil can lead to engine wear, which can, in turn, cause leaks.

Ford Mustang Oil Leak Inspection
The first step involves inspecting the vehicle for any visible oil leaks. Technicians identify the source of the leak, whether it’s from the engine, transmission, or oil pan gasket. They use specialized tools to spot small leaks that may not be immediately noticeable.
Ford Mustang Oil Pan Gasket Replacement
The oil pan gasket seals the oil pan to the engine block. Over time, the gasket can wear out and cause leaks. Replacing it involves draining the oil, removing the pan, and fitting a new gasket, ensuring a tight seal to prevent future leaks.
Ford Mustang Valve Cover Gasket Repair
The valve cover gasket seals the engine’s valve cover, preventing oil from leaking out. If this gasket fails, oil can drip onto the engine. A repair involves replacing the gasket and ensuring all bolts are correctly tightened to avoid further leakage.
Ford Mustang Oil Filter Replacement
A faulty or improperly installed oil filter can cause oil leaks. Technicians replace the oil filter and ensure it’s installed correctly to prevent oil from escaping. They also check the oil pressure to ensure it’s at optimal levels to avoid leaks from other components.
Ford Mustang Front & Rear Main Seal Replacement
The front and rear main seals prevent oil from leaking out of the engine where the crankshaft passes through the engine block. These seals can wear out over time and may need replacement to stop leaks. The repair is typically labor-intensive as it requires disassembling parts of the engine.
Ford Mustang Timing Cover Gasket Replacement
The timing cover protects the timing belt or chain and is sealed with a gasket. If this gasket fails, oil can leak. Replacing the timing cover gasket involves removing the timing cover, cleaning the area, and installing a new gasket to restore the seal.
Ford Mustang Oil Pressure Sensor Replacement
A faulty oil pressure sensor can sometimes cause oil leaks or lead to incorrect readings. Replacing the oil pressure sensor ensures proper oil pressure monitoring and prevents leaks associated with a malfunctioning sensor, which might indicate a potential oil leak.
Ford Mustang Transmission Seal Replacement
Leaks from the transmission can also be mistaken for engine oil leaks. Technicians can replace faulty transmission seals to stop oil from leaking. This repair ensures that the transmission fluid remains at the proper levels, preventing damage to the transmission system.
Ford Mustang Turbocharger Oil Leak Repair
In vehicles with turbochargers, oil leaks can occur from the oil feed or return lines. Replacing faulty seals or lines associated with the turbo system is crucial to prevent oil from leaking and causing engine damage. This is often a specialized repair requiring advanced expertise.
Ford Mustang Oil Drain Plug Replacement
The oil drain plug is the component through which oil is drained during an oil change. If it’s damaged or worn, it can cause oil leaks. Replacing a worn-out drain plug is an easy fix that ensures no oil escapes from the oil pan during operation.
